CYPRUS 1932 SG118, 120/22 Cover First Flight by Imperial Airways to Iraq

Stock Code: P201000333

1932 (19 AP) cover from Limassol to Basrah, endorsed 'first flight Cyprus to Irak', franked by 1925 ½pi green, 1½pi scarlet, 2pi yellow and black, and 2½pi bright blue, tied by three despatch cds, with perforated black/blue airmail etiquette at upper left. Carried on the first direct Imperial Airways flight from London to India calling at Cyprus. Backstamped at Tiberius (19 AP), Basrah (20 and 23 APR) and Beyrouth (27 Apr), having been returned to sender. Minor blemishes, but scarce. Only 30 believed to have been flown to Basrah.
